# aromatic rings of various sizes:
|
|
#
|
|
# Note that with the aromatics, it's important to include the ring-size queries along with
|
|
# the aromaticity query for two reasons:
|
|
# 1) Much of the current feature-location code assumes that the feature point is
|
|
# equidistant from the atoms defining it. Larger definitions like: a1aaaaaaaa1 will actually
|
|
# match things like 'o1c2cccc2ccc1', which have an aromatic unit spread across multiple simple
|
|
# rings and so don't fit that requirement.
|
|
# 2) It's *way* faster.
|
|
#
|
|
|
|
#
|
|
# 21.1.2008 (GL): update ring membership tests to reflect corrected meaning of
|
|
# "r" in SMARTS parser
